EPC Contractor Status Clause Samples

EPC Contractor Status. Subject to the terms and conditions of this Agreement: (a) with respect to any Plant or Licensee Plant construction project obtained by a Licensee in its capacity as sales representative under Section 2.1, such Licensee will have the first right to perform engineering, procurement and construction contracts (EPC Contracts) arising in connection therewith; and (b) with respect to any Licensee Plant or Plant construction project for which a Licensee is a sublicensor of the Licensor Technology, such Licensee will have the first right to perform EPC Contracts arising in connection therewith. As used herein, first right means that such Licensee may within 10 days after the execution of the applicable License Agreement, provide written notice to Licensor that Licensee opts not to provide such services (in which case, Licensor may provide such services if it so decides); provided that if no such notice is received by Licensor within such 10 day period, such Licensee will be deemed to have exercised its right to perform such services. Notwithstanding the foregoing, Licensor will have the right to review and approve, prior to commencement of construction, the design engineering package and detail engineering package (at Licensee’s cost and at Licensor’s then-standard rates) relating to or arising from each of the [***] (whether for Plants or Licensee Plants) commenced subsequent to the Effective Date that qualify as either an Ethanol Project or a Sugar Project. Licensor will include the Licensees on its customary list of qualified contractors.
